Muñoz retains Andretti drive for 2016

– Andretti Autosport has confirmed that Carlos Muñoz will remain with the squad in IndyCar next season.Muñoz, 23, finished second on his debut in the series at the 2013 Indianapolis 500 and has competed full-time for the team across the past two campaigns.Muñoz finished the 2015 championship in 13th position, having collected his maiden victory in Detroit."I'm really happy to join the team again for 2016 – it will be my fifth year with Andretti," said Muñoz, referring to his 2012-13 stint in IndyLights."The 2016 schedule looks really nice and we hope to fight for an Indianapolis 500 win and a championship."
